Wordlock chests containing essential quest items are relatively easy to find, either located near roads or their locations being disclosed through interaction with NPCs. Gorath, a moredhel, can read it, and casting the Union spell allows Patrus to do so for short periods of time. The moredhel alphabet is a character substitution of the A-Z alphabet. If no member of the player's party can read moredhel, the writing on the chest will appear untranslated, although it can still be opened by trying each possible combination. Wordlock chests can hold valuable items and equipment, as well as quest items essential to completing the game. These chests have combination locks with letters on each dial, and a riddle written upon them whose answer opens the chest. One of the game's unique features are moredhel wordlock chests. While traveling, the party camps in the wilderness to rest and recover lost health and stamina, provided that there are no enemies in the vicinity.

The game has two possible views, the 3D first-person view and the 2D top-down map view, where the player is represented with a triangular marker. The user interface is mouse-driven, with keyboard hotkeys for most actions. Gameplay occurs mainly from a first-person perspective while traveling in the overworld, dungeons, and caves, but switches to a third-person view during combat. Its protracted development experience considerable problems, and the finished product not nearly as warmly received as Betrayal. PyroTechnix completed a long-anticipated sequel, Return to Krondor, which was released by Sierra in 1998. The game is designed to resemble a book, separated into chapters and narrated in the third-person with a quick-save bookmark feature.Īlthough neither the dialog nor narrative were written by Feist himself, the game is considered canon as it was later novelized by Feist as Krondor: The Betrayal, and events in the game were subsequently written into his later Riftwar novels.
